DIFFERENT generations came together to mark Remembrance Sunday by laying a poppy wreath from Ramsey and Parkeston Parish Council at a new war memorial.

Council chairman Bill Davidson was joined by youngster Roxy Priestnall to lay the wreath.

Mr Davidson designed the war memorial alongside other members of the cemetery committee, including councillors Tanya Ferguson and Rob Passmore, and volunteer cemetery administrator Lin Keaton in collaboration with the stonemasons who made the memorial.

The inscription on the memorial reads “When you go home, tell them of us and say, for your tomorrow, we gave our today”, and “At the going down of the sun and in the morning, we will remember them”.

In addition to the new war memorial, there have been other improvements to Parkeston cemetery, such as refurbishing the chapel, seed planting, maintenance and security by the committee and other councillors.

Mr Davidson said: “As chairman of the parish council, I am really proud of what we’ve achieved with this monument. 

“As a parish council, we worked for two years to get this together.

“For our fallen heroes, I think it’s a fitting monument. 

“It’s good for Parkeston to have their own memorial. It’s settled in nicely into Parkeston cemetery.”
